First, drive carefully. Even if a person only got hold of a few speeding tickets or had a few accidents, a higher car insurance policy rate still awaits him. It is always best to have zero record of any driving offenses. Instead of consuming your hard-earned money for insurance premiums, be wary in obeying all traffic regulations so you can keep your money in your own pocket.
Take note also of different discounts that car insurance companies are offering. Get familiar with their promos to maximize your benefits. For example, you can incorporate all of your vehicles under one policy to receive a multiple vehicle discount.
Another is to insure your house and your vehicle in the same policy, so you can avail of a multiple line discount. It is also worth inquiring if companies give credit for good student card report, low mileage, airbag and anti-theft safety systems, age of car, and occupational and auto club discounts. The more discounts you accumulate, the more money you can save.
Additional car insurance tips: increase your deductibles if you can, with a reasonable price. Your deductible is how much you will have to initially pay when you make a claim before the insurance company steps in and helps with the costs. If you maintain a minimal deductible, like 250 dollars, your premium will increase. If you have a bigger deductible, say 500 dollars, your premium will decrease respectively.

The best way to save money on your insurance is to search around. An insurance with the lowest premium may not be best bet, there may be some differences with the coverage with other insurances. To be sure, make a comparison of different plans with similar coverage, deductibles, and limitations, so you know you’re really getting the best possible deal.
